Marco Piccioni




Marco Piccioni is a postdoctoral researcher at the Chair of Software Engineering, ETH Zurich. After having received a Ph.D. from ETH for his work on API usability, persistence, and object-oriented class schema evolution, his research interests are now focused on online education, and MOOCs in particular. Previously he worked for Sistemi Informativi S.p.A. (an IBM company) for ten years as a technical trainer and software developer. He has a Laurea degree in Mathematics from Università La Sapienza, Roma, and a Master degree in Economics from Università L. Bocconi, Milano.

More info:

E.g., 2016-10-21
E.g., 2016-10-21
E.g., 2016-10-21
Nov 10th 2015

Learn functional programming, design patterns, loop invariants, and more in part 2 of this introductory programming course.

No votes yet
Sep 22nd 2015

Learn the principles and techniques behind modern Information Technology.

Average: 1 (1 vote)